Leon, > Then there are the Philips LPC2000 ARM chips - cheap, fast and 32 bit. carefull... I bought one of those kits hoping to use it, but sadly the IO is limited to a max frequency of around 3Mhz, even if the internal core is running at 60Mhz, its to do with the way Philips interfaced the ARM core.
